KEGG   ORTHOLOGY: K09587
Entry
K09587                      KO                                     
Symbol
CYP90B, DWF4
Name
steroid 22S-hydroxylase [EC:1.14.14.178]
Pathway
map00905  Brassinosteroid biosynthesis
map01100  Metabolic pathways
map01110  Biosynthesis of secondary metabolites
Module
M00371  Castasterone biosynthesis, campesterol => castasterone
Reaction
R07430  6-oxocampestanol,NADPH:brassinosteroid C22alpha-hydroxylase
R07445  campesterol,NADPH---hemoprotein reductase:oxygen 22S-oxidoreductase (hydroxylating)
R07452  campest-4-en-3-one,NADPH---hemoprotein reductase:oxygen 22S-oxidoreductase (hydroxylating)
R07453  5alpha-campestan-3-one,NADPH---hemoprotein reductase:oxygen 22S-oxidoreductase (hydroxylating)
R07454  campestanol,NADPH---hemoprotein reductase:oxygen 22S-oxidoreductase (hydroxylating)
